Ford Motor Company of Canada, Limited (
French:
Ford du Canada Limitée) was founded on August 17, 1904 for the purpose of manufacturing and selling Ford automobiles in
Canada and the
British Empire. It was originally known as the Walkerville Wagon Works, and was located in Walkerville, Ontario (now part of
Windsor,
Ontario). The founder, Gordon McGregor, convinced a group of investors to invest in
Henry Ford's new automobile which was being produced across the river in Detroit.
